Our practice
Prana Loft began in 2016 as a rooftop practice for a handful of friends who were tired of yoga that felt like a workout with a deadline. We wanted a room that gave time back — where the teacher watches you, not the clock, and where a beginner and a decade-long practitioner can breathe in the same circle.
Today we're a small studio in Tapovan, five minutes from the Ganga. Wooden floors, tall windows, mountain light. No mirrors, no scoreboards, no rush. Just breath, movement, and a room built to slow you down.

Go deeper
Twice a year we open a small residential training — twenty-two days of asana, philosophy, anatomy and the quiet craft of holding a room. Yoga Alliance aligned, taught by Ishani and our senior faculty, capped at fourteen trainees so no one gets lost.
